Praveen Aggarwal
  • Dermatologist
# C-2 Panchseel Garden, Delhi, Delhi, None, Delhi, Delhi.
Review
Locations

Aggarwal Clinic

# C-2 Panchseel Garden, Delhi, Delhi, Delhi.
Review about Praveen Aggarwal
Loading